Job description

What You’ll Do

Provide front-line leadership for the Data Center Thermal & Cooling Engineering team, driving NTI, advanced engineering, and next-generation product innovation for AI-driven Data Centers. Partner with global engineering, product strategy, sales, and business leaders to define technology roadmaps and deliver solutions including liquid cooling, direct-to-chip cooling, immersion cooling, CDU systems, liquid-cooled DC-DC converters, and advanced thermal management technologies. Lead the development of future-ready cooling, power conversion, and energy infrastructure solutions spanning BBUs, high-density PSUs, advanced controls, SiC/GaN technologies, and emerging VDC and MVDC architectures, while building a high-performing team and fostering cross-functional collaboration to drive innovation, growth, and technology leadership.

  • Front-Line Leadership & Technical Direction

Lead and inspire a high-performing team of 8-10 Mechanical, Thermal, and Power Electronics engineers, fostering a culture of innovation, accountability, collaboration, and technical excellence.

Provide technical leadership, coaching, and strategic direction while championing Digital Engineering, Model-Based Design, DFSS, and Eaton's Technology Development Processes.

Technology Strategy, Market Intelligence & Commercialization Drive technology strategy by assessing Data Center market trends, customer needs, competitive landscapes, regulatory requirements, and emerging technologies, translating insights into product roadmaps and innovation initiatives.

Develop strong business cases, technology proposals, and commercialization strategies in collaboration with product strategy, business leaders, customers, and external partners.

Program Execution & Delivery Excellence Lead advanced engineering and NTI programs from concept through commercialization, ensuring execution excellence, risk management, and achievement of key business milestones.

Collaborate across global engineering, operations, sales, supply chain, and program management teams to deliver innovative solutions while driving customer intimacy, speed of execution, and value engineering.

Workforce Planning, Resource Management & Budget Ownership Own engineering workforce planning, resource allocation, and organizational capability development to ensure alignment with strategic business priorities.

Manage engineering budgets, technology investments, laboratory infrastructure, capital expenditures, and engineering tools to enable efficient program execution.

Talent Development & Organizational Capability Building Develop and execute talent strategies for hiring, engagement, succession planning, retention, and capability development aligned with Data Center growth objectives.

Coach, mentor, and develop future leaders while fostering a culture of continuous learning, professional growth, and high performance.

Qualifications

Master Degree in Mechanical/Thermal Engineering with proven leadership in Data Center cooling, thermal management, and technology development.

8-15 years of experience in a multinational environment, working with OEMs, Hyperscalers, and Data Center customers on advanced cooling and infrastructure solutions.

3+ years of engineering leadership experience, managing multidisciplinary teams in thermal, cooling, power, or related technologies.
